Founded in 2009, Blue Line Sterilization Services has been focused to reducing the time to market for innovators crafting new medical devices. The company differentiates itself by maintaining a bank of 8 cubic foot ethylene oxide (EO) sterilizers, providing FDA and EU compliant sterilization with turnaround times typically between 1 to 3 days—an achievement unattainable with larger EO sterilization services.

Co-founders Brant and Jane Gard realized the vital need for accelerated sterilization options, particularly for rapid development programs designing innovative medical devices. The ability to swiftly navigate through device iterations is fundamental in reducing the need for additional funding, preserving the value of investors' equity, and expediting time to market. Faster service and reduced time to market hold considerable value for employees, investors, and the patients benefiting from improved medical care.

Besides routine sterilization, Blue Line offers rapid turnkey validations and small batch releases that support clinical trials and FDA/CE submissions. Why Sterilization of Medical Instruments is Critical

Infection control remains a fundamental pillar of modern medicine.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) estimate that around 1 in 31 hospital patients experiences at least one healthcare-associated infection (HAI). Effective sterilization of medical devices markedly reduces the risk of these infections, safeguarding patients and healthcare providers concurrently. Poor sterilization can trigger outbreaks of dangerous diseases like hepatitis, HIV, and antibiotic-resistant bacterial infections.

Sterilization Techniques for Medical Devices

The science behind sterilization has grown considerably over the last century, leveraging a variety of methods suited to multiple types of devices and materials. Some of the most frequently utilized techniques include:

Sterilization Using Autoclaves

Autoclaving remains the most widespread and trusted method of sterilization, particularly suitable for surgical instruments and reusable metal devices. Using high-pressure saturated steam at temperatures around 121–134°C, autoclaving effectively kills bacteria, viruses, fungi, and spores. This method is rapid, inexpensive, and environmentally safe, although not suitable for heat-sensitive materials.

Innovative Advancements in Device Sterilization in Healthcare

As the landscape evolves, several key trends are affecting device sterilization standards:

Eco-Conscious Sterilization Approaches

As eco-friendly mandates tighten, businesses are progressively investing in eco-friendly sterilization techniques. Steps include limiting reliance on hazardous chemicals like ethylene oxide, exploring reusable packaging options, and optimizing resource use in sterilization methods.

Advanced Materials and Device Complexity

The proliferation of sophisticated medical devices—such as robotic surgery instruments and intricate diagnostic equipment—demands sterilization processes capable of handling delicate materials. Evolution in sterilization include methods like low-temperature plasma sterilization and hydrogen peroxide vapor, which can sterilize without damaging sensitive components.

Enhanced Digital Tracking Systems

With advances in digital technology, traceability of sterilization procedures is now more precise than ever. Digital traceability systems offer thorough documentation, automated compliance checks, and real-time messages, significantly diminishing human error and strengthening patient safety.
